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93789520237 4493 358 25602438
85772914570 68472 28125327964
85772914570 68472 28125327964
55 8645459715 89778 51762
All about undefined
Interested in learning more?
85772914570 68472 28125327964
55 8645459715 89778 51762
See more
41467578 7881 871
50994082 5979214 708464579 094
See more
30 27393
07 0526 536
See more